>John Culleton wrote:
> > Most indexing programs, including Makeindex, Xindy, Cindex etc. will
> > automatically collapse successive page numbers into a page range.
>Before Hans starts implementing this, I want to note that instead
>of 45-46 frequently a 45f is used (or '45 f.' or '45 f'). Instead of
>45-47 or 45-54 some use also 45 ff.
>
>Tobias
actually, this is quite easy to implement in the current version, but what
key/value to use in the setup ... (of course the f/ff should be
configurable and i shoul dnot forget to document it then)
